    Just A Point…

     

     Just a point , in a line,

    just an instant, stuck in time,

    wandering, wondering evermore,

    then washed upon some foreign shore.

    Come to root, and grow to learn

    Discontent and disconcerne

     

      Time moves us.

     

    Now we drift away from strife,,

    protein coated viral life.

    To find another willing cell,

    to do the thing we do most well

    .

      Time moves us

     

    What remnant strain takes hold this day?

    What influence shall shape our way?

    As in the past it comes again,

    although we can’t remember when..

     

       Time moves us.

     

    Ejected, blown, into space,

    solar wind and human race.

    All time passed and none to tell,

    we land upon another cell.

     

        Time moves us.

     

    From cell to cell we make our way,

    Infectious strands of DNA

    Do we really have a choice?

    Listen to your inner voice.

     

        Time moves on..

     

     

     

    D,Scolnik.
